引言
在管理学领域,网格图计算是一种重要的决策分析方法,它通过图形化的方式展示决策变量之间的关系,帮助管理者进行复杂问题的分析和决策。然而,网格图计算在实际应用中常常会遇到各种难题。本文将深入探讨这些难题,并提供实用的技巧来破解它们。
一、网格图计算难题概述
1. 数据复杂性
网格图计算依赖于大量的数据,这些数据可能来自不同的来源,具有不同的格式和结构。数据复杂性是网格图计算中遇到的首要难题。
2. 决策变量众多
在许多管理问题中,决策变量众多,这会导致网格图变得庞大而复杂,难以直观理解和分析。
3. 模型选择困难
不同的管理问题可能需要不同的网格图模型,选择合适的模型对于解决问题至关重要。
二、破解技巧
1. 数据预处理
- 数据清洗:对原始数据进行清洗,去除无效和错误的数据。
- 数据整合:将来自不同来源的数据整合到一个统一的格式中。
- 数据标准化:对数据进行标准化处理,确保数据的一致性。
import pandas as pd
# 示例:数据清洗和整合
data = pd.read_csv('data.csv')
cleaned_data = data.dropna() # 去除缺失值
integrated_data = cleaned_data.merge(data2, on='key') # 整合数据
2. 简化决策变量
- 变量筛选:通过相关性分析等方法筛选出对结果影响显著的变量。
- 变量合并:将具有相似属性的变量合并为一个变量。
import numpy as np
# 示例:变量筛选
correlation_matrix = np.corrcoef(data.columns)
significant_variables = correlation_matrix[np.triu_indices_from(correlation_matrix, k=1)].abs().sum(axis=1) > 0.5
3. 模型选择与优化
- 模型比较:比较不同模型的优缺点,选择最合适的模型。
- 模型优化:通过调整模型参数来优化模型性能。
from sklearn.linear_model import LinearRegression
# 示例:模型选择与优化
model = LinearRegression()
model.fit(X_train, y_train)
model_optimized = model
三、案例分析
以某公司产品线优化问题为例,通过数据预处理、简化决策变量和模型选择与优化等技巧,成功解决了网格图计算难题。
四、结论
网格图计算在管理学中的应用具有重要意义,但同时也面临着诸多难题。通过数据预处理、简化决策变量和模型选择与优化等实用技巧,可以有效破解这些难题,提高管理决策的效率和准确性。
